Passenger waiting shed inaugurated

BANDERDEWA, Mar 12: A passenger waiting shed was inaugurated by 138 Bn Central Reserve Police Force (CRPF) Commandant Paras Nath here near the check gate on Tuesday.
The shed was constructed by the 138 Bn of the CRPF under its civic action programme 2018-19.
Speaking on the occasion, the commandant said that the shed was constructed for the convenience of the civil public who commute between Assam and Arunachal Pradesh, and so that it could provide some shelter during rain and from the scorching sun.
Among others, Circle Officer Jumyir Ronya Kato, 138 Bn CRPF Second-in-Command Harish Chandra Kumar, and other officers of 138 Bn CRPF, local police and civilians were present.
